Living their motto of “Men for Others,” alumni spanning eight decades are returning to Carrollton and Banks on the evenings of October 21-23 for the 2019-2020 Alumni Giving Drive (AGD). The AGD is the alumni component of Jesuit’s annual giving effort.

Proceeds from the alumni drive are combined with dollars raised in the Parents’ Giving Drive and Parents of Alumni Drive to offset operational expenses of the school, allowing Jesuit to remain an affordable school of excellence. Jesuit remains one of the least expensive parochial schools in the New Orleans area and is the most affordable Jesuit high school in the nation.
Last year during the three nights of connecting with classmates, alumni volunteers secured pledges from approximately 1,300 of their classmates totaling $430,000.
The chairman of the 2019-20 drive is J.P. Escudier, who is a member of the Class of 1995. The drive is organized by Mrs. Logan Diano, Jesuit’s Alumni Giving Drive coordinator.
